Lifting and moving the TV
Please note the following advice to prevent the TV from being
scratched or damaged and for safe transportation regardless of its
type and size.
• It is recommended to move the TV in the box or packing material
that the TV originally came in.
• Before moving or lifting the TV, disconnect the power cord and
all cables.
• When holding the TV, the screen should face
away from you to avoid damage.
• Hold the top and bottom of the TV frame firmly. Make sure not to
hold the transparent part, speaker, or speaker grille area.
• When transporting the TV, do not expose the TV to jolts or
excessive vibration.
• When transporting the TV, keep the TV upright; never turn the TV
on its side or tilt towards the left or right.
• Do not apply excessive pressure to cause flexing /bending of frame
chassis as it may damage screen.
CAUTION
• Avoid touching the screen at all times, as this may result in
damage to the screen.
• When handling the TV, be careful not to damage the protruding
joystick button.
Setting up the TV
CAUTION
• Do not carry the TV upside-down by holding the stand body (or
stand base) as this may cause it to fall off, resulting in damage
or injury.
• When attaching the stand to the TV set, place the screen facing
down on a cushioned table or flat surface to protect the screen
from scratches.
• When detaching the stand to the TV set, place the screen facing
down on a cushioned table or flat surface to protect the screen
from scratches.
• If you don`t fasten the screw tightly, TV will fall down and get
damaged.
• Tighten the screws firmly to prevent the TV from tilting forward.
Do not over tighten.
• Lift up the latch at the bottom of the stand base and detach the
stand base from the TV.
